Main Idea
Cardano (ADA) experiences significant price volatility, leading to a 1,512% liquidation imbalance and over $12M in losses for bulls, while potential ecosystem support and DeFi wallet integration could aid a price reversal.
Key Points
1. Cardano's price dropped to $0.8208, causing long position traders to lose $13.08 million in 24 hours.
2. A 1,512% liquidation imbalance occurred as ADA's price fell from a high of $0.8601 to $0.8008 before a partial recovery.
3.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) reached 78.01, indicating an overbought zone and triggering profit-taking.
4. Cardano's integration into Blockchain.com’s DeFi Wallet could support price recovery by increasing accessibility to 37 million users.
5. Trading volume declined by 48.02% to $1.72 billion, requiring an increase to sustain a potential rebound toward $1.
